Julie Beth Joseph Koop, born on May 22, 1953, in Los Angeles, CA, peacefully went home to her Lord and Savior on April 29, 2025. Julie was the beloved daughter of Carmen Cable and the late Harry Joseph. She leaves behind her devoted husband of 38 years, Ken Koop, residing in Fresno, and her son John Griffin and his wife Heather, who live in Helendale, CA. Julie was a cherished grandmother to Misty, Tyler, Logan, and Tristan, and a great-grandmother to seven great-grandchildren.
Julie is also survived by her sisters, Linda Duncan of Fresno and Toni Vanderwege and her husband Chuck of San Jose, as well as her brother Greg Joseph and his wife Tina of Parker, Colorado. She was a loving sister-in-law to Grace and Ray of Fresno, Sharon and Mike of Tracy, and Nadine and Robert of Fresno. Julie's extended family includes nine nieces and nephews and six great-nieces and nephews. She was predeceased by her sister Susan Dusi.
Growing up in West Covina and Big Bear Lake in southern California, Julie graduated from Big Bear Lake High School in 1971, where she was actively involved in school activities, including the Ski Team, Song Leader, and was crowned Big Bear Lake Snow Queen. Julie had a successful career in the stocks and bonds industry, retiring from Wells Fargo Advisors after 22 years of dedicated service.
Julie was a devoted Christian, deeply committed to her faith. She was actively involved in Northwest Church Special Needs, teaching Sunday School for many years. Her passion for helping others extended to her participation in Prison Fellowship and mentoring in the Timothy Program, where she led many to know and follow Jesus Christ as their personal Lord and Savior.
In lieu of flowers, the family request remembrances be made to Break The Barriers, Fresno CA.
